Role Summary
We are looking for a Perception / Computer Vision Engineer to design, develop, and deploy real-time vision systems for autonomous and intelligent robotic platforms. This role involves working closely with real sensor data, production constraints, and cross-functional robotics teams to convert perception algorithms into reliable, deployable systems.
Key Responsibilities:
1. Computer Vision & Perception Development
Design and implement computer vision pipelines using Open CV and Python
Develop and fine-tune YOLO-based object detection models (YOLOv5 / YOLOv7 / YOLOv8)
Work on object detection, tracking, classification, and region-of-interest extraction
Handle challenges related to lighting variation, motion blur, occlusion, and noise
Perform camera calibration, distortion correction, and image preprocessing
2. Model Training & Optimization
Prepare and manage datasets: annotation, augmentation, and validation
Train, evaluate, and fine-tune YOLO models for real-world performance
Optimize models for latency, FPS, and memory usage
Analyze false positives / false negatives and improve model robustness
3. Deployment & Integration
Integrate perception modules with robotics software stacks
Ensure real-time inference on edge/embedded systems
Collaborate with autonomy, controls, and hardware teams
Debug perception issues during field testing and deployments
4. Engineering & Collaboration
Write clean, modular, and well-documented Python code
Participate in design reviews and technical discussions
Take ownership of perception components from concept to deployment
Continuously improve system reliability and performance
